(COBALT, ON) Members of the Temiskaming Det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) responded to an alarm on June 6, 2014 at approximately 3:23 a.m.
Police arrived at the Cobalt Mining Museum and observed broken glass at the premise. The suspect(s) had departed upon police arrival. Through investigation two men face charges.
Lyle ASH, 21, of Cobalt is charged for Break and Enter section 348(1)(a) of the Criminal Code and Fail to Comply with Probation section 733.1(1) of the Criminal Code.
Luc BEDARD, 21, of Cobalt is charged for Break and Enter section 348(1)(a) of the Criminal Code and Mischief section 430(4) of the Criminal Code.
Both accused will appear at Ontario Court of Justice in Haileybury on July 29, 2014.
